This episode explores how limited partners are increasingly turning to direct secondary sales to achieve liquidity in venture capital portfolios. Lucas and Luna examine a specific case: a mid-sized university endowment that sold stakes in five mature venture-backed companies through a directed secondary process in late 2025, achieving a 1.8x multiple and an IRR of 14 percent on a blended basis. They unpack the mechanics of direct secondaries, how they differ from traditional fund-level secondaries, why 2026 has seen a surge in these deals, and what LPs should watch for when pricing and structuring such transactions. The conversation also touches on the role of dedicated secondary funds, the importance of company-stage considerations, and how liquidity events are reshaping LP portfolio construction.
